AI Development Platforms: Google Cloud AI, Azure AI, and AWS AI Services

Explore AI Development Platforms That Provide Comprehensive Environments for Building AI Applications

AI development platforms offer comprehensive environments for building, training, and deploying AI applications. In this forum, we will explore platforms like Google Cloud AI, Microsoft Azure AI, and AWS AI Services. We will discuss their features, advantages, and how to choose the right platform for your needs. Participants are encouraged to share their experiences, examples of AI projects, and best practices for leveraging these platforms.

AI Development Platforms

1. Introduction to AI Development Platforms

Description: Gain an overview of the most popular AI development platforms and their applications in different business scenarios.

Key Platforms:

  • Google Cloud AI: A suite of AI and machine learning products and services offered by Google Cloud.
  • Microsoft Azure AI: A set of AI services and tools provided by Microsoft Azure for building intelligent applications.
  • AWS AI Services: A collection of AI services offered by Amazon Web Services (AWS) for various AI and machine learning tasks.

Potential Benefits:

  • Comprehensive Tools: Access to a wide range of tools and services for end-to-end AI development.
  • Scalability: Scale AI applications to handle large datasets and complex computations.
  • Integration: Seamless integration with other cloud services and existing systems.

Example:

  • Finance: Use Google Cloud AI to build predictive models for risk assessment and fraud detection.

2. Google Cloud AI

Description: Explore Google Cloud AI, its features, and how to get started with this powerful AI development platform.

Key Features:

  • AutoML: Build high-quality custom machine learning models with minimal effort.
  • TensorFlow: Access TensorFlow, an open-source machine learning framework, for building AI models.
  • Pre-trained Models: Use pre-trained models for common tasks like image recognition and natural language processing.

Getting Started:

  • Setup: Guide to setting up Google Cloud AI on your platform.
  • Tutorials: Resources for beginners to start using Google Cloud AI features.
  • Community: Join Google Cloud AI forums and community groups for support.

Potential Benefits:

  • Ease of Use: User-friendly tools and interfaces for building AI applications.
  • Performance: High-performance computing capabilities for large-scale AI tasks.
  • Support: Access to comprehensive documentation and community resources.

Example:

  • Healthcare: Use Google Cloud AI for medical imaging analysis and diagnostics.

3. Microsoft Azure AI

Description: Learn about Microsoft Azure AI, its advantages, and how to leverage this AI development platform for building intelligent applications.

Key Features:

  • Azure Machine Learning: A cloud-based environment for training, deploying, and managing machine learning models.
  • Cognitive Services: Pre-built APIs for vision, speech, language, and decision-making tasks.
  • Bot Services: Tools for building and deploying AI-powered chatbots.

Getting Started:

  • Setup: Step-by-step guide to setting up Microsoft Azure AI.
  • Tutorials: Beginner-friendly tutorials to start building AI applications with Azure AI.
  • Community: Participate in Azure AI forums and community discussions.

Potential Benefits:

  • Integration: Seamlessly integrates with other Microsoft products and services.
  • Flexibility: Supports a wide range of AI and machine learning frameworks.
  • Scalability: Scales easily to handle large datasets and complex AI tasks.

Example:

  • Retail: Use Microsoft Azure AI for personalized customer recommendations and sales forecasting.

4. AWS AI Services

Description: Discover AWS AI Services, its features, and how to utilize this comprehensive AI platform for various AI and machine learning tasks.

Key Features:

  • Amazon SageMaker: A fully managed service for building, training, and deploying machine learning models.
  • Rekognition: An image and video analysis service that uses deep learning models.
  • Lex: A service for building conversational interfaces using voice and text.

Getting Started:

  • Setup: Guide to setting up AWS AI Services on your platform.
  • Tutorials: Resources for building AI applications with AWS AI Services.
  • Community: Engage with the AWS community for support and collaboration.

Potential Benefits:

  • Comprehensive: A wide range of services for different AI and machine learning needs.
  • Performance: High-performance infrastructure for demanding AI applications.
  • Support: Access to extensive documentation and support resources.

Example:

  • Manufacturing: Use AWS AI Services for predictive maintenance and quality control.

5. Applications of AI Development Platforms in Various Industries

Description: Discuss how AI development platforms can be applied across different industries to drive business growth and innovation.

Key Industries:

  • Finance: Use AI platforms for risk assessment, fraud detection, and investment analysis.
  • Healthcare: Implement AI for patient data analysis, diagnostics, and personalized treatment plans.
  • Retail: Leverage AI for customer segmentation, sales forecasting, and inventory management.

Potential Benefits:

  • Operational Efficiency: Improve operational efficiency by automating data analysis and decision-making.
  • Customer Satisfaction: Enhance customer satisfaction through personalized and optimized services.
  • Data-Driven Decisions: Make informed decisions based on accurate and comprehensive AI analysis.

Example:

  • Insurance: Use Microsoft Azure AI to predict claim probabilities and optimize risk management.

Sharing Best Practices and Lessons Learned

1. Share Your AI Development Platform Selection Journey

Description: Share your experiences with selecting AI development platforms to help others understand the benefits and challenges.

Key Steps:

  • Outline Objectives: Clearly outline your objectives for selecting an AI development platform and how they align with your business goals.
  • Describe Challenges: Detail the challenges faced during the selection process and how they were overcome.
  • Highlight Results: Showcase the results achieved, including quantitative and qualitative benefits.

Example:

  • Tech Companies: Share how selecting the right AI development platform improved product development and innovation.

2. Provide Practical Tips

Description: Share practical tips and best practices for successfully selecting and using AI development platforms.

Key Steps:

  • Selection Criteria: Provide tips on defining and prioritizing selection criteria based on business needs.
  • Evaluation Process: Share strategies for evaluating and comparing different AI platforms.
  • Implementation Planning: Offer advice on planning for successful implementation and integration.

Example:

  • Retailers: Share tips on selecting AI platforms for enhancing customer engagement and sales forecasting.

3. Recommend Resources

Description: Share resources that can help others successfully select and implement AI development platforms.

Key Steps:

  • List Tutorials: Recommend tutorials and courses that provide guidance on selecting and using AI platforms.
  • Highlight Useful Tools: Share information about tools and platforms that facilitated your AI development journey.
  • Point to Support Channels: Provide links to support forums, documentation, and community groups.

Example:

  • Data Scientists: Recommend resources for using Google Cloud AI and AWS AI Services in data analysis and machine learning.

Join the Discussion

Join our forum to explore AI development platforms that provide comprehensive environments for building AI applications. Discuss platforms like Google Cloud AI, Microsoft Azure AI, and AWS AI Services. Learn about their features, advantages, and how to choose the right platform for your needs. Share your experiences, insights, and best practices for leveraging these platforms in various projects.

For more discussions and resources on AI, visit our forum at AI Resource Zone. Engage with a community of experts and enthusiasts to stay updated with the latest trends and advancements in AI and Machine Learning.